explain why 8÷5 =8/5?

Respuesta :

MakbelJ360577 MakbelJ360577
  • 03-11-2022

8÷5 and 8/5 are just equal to each other because the symbol "÷" means division as well as the fraction bar "/".

8÷5 = 1.6

8/5 = 1.6 as well.
